Mourinho delivers latest Man United injury update ahead of Everton trip
Jose Mourinho gives the latest Manchester United team news ahead of Sunday's trip to Everton
Luke Shaw has been ruled out of Manchester United’s trip to Everton on Sunday due to injury, Jose Mourinho has confirmed.
The defender picked up a knock during the 4-1 EFL Cup quarter-final win over West Ham United on Wednesday night and has been ruled out of the trip to Goodison Park.
However, the Red Devils are set to welcome Paul Pogba and Marouane Fellaini back from suspension for the trip to Merseyside.
United will also be without the suspended Wayne Rooney for their clash against Ronald Koeman’s men at Goodison Park.
Speaking at his pre-match news conference on Friday afternoon, Mourinho commented on the latest Manchester United team news ahead of the game.
Mourinho is quoted as saying by United’s website: “The injury [to Luke] is a pity.
“We were on this process of developing him as a player – he has a lot to learn and great potential to develop so we were giving him 90 minutes. Not consecutive matches but 90 minutes against Feyenoord then, one week later, 90 minutes against West Ham, but he got this little injury.
“In the squad, we are in a very good position with injuries – the two central defenders and Luke is what we have. Everybody is doing really well to keep that record good in such a difficult season with so many matches. Hopefully, we progress in the cup competitions and have more cup games to play in the second part of the season.
“Wayne’s absence comes in the sequence of the yellow cards that stopped Ibra [Zlatan Ibrahimovic] playing against Arsenal, the sequence of yellow cards that stopped Marouane Fellaini and Paul Pogba playing against West Ham. But, OK, everybody makes mistakes and [it’s] no problem.”
